Example #1
Source File: crypto.js    From lyswhut-lx-music-desktop with Apache License 2.0 5 votes vote down vote up
rsaEncrypt = (buffer, key) => {
  buffer = Buffer.concat([Buffer.alloc(128 - buffer.length), buffer])
  return publicEncrypt({ key: key, padding: constants.RSA_NO_PADDING }, buffer)
}
